Zagir Mukhtarpashaevich Shakhiev (Russian : Загир Мухтарпашаевич Шахиев; born 15 April 1999) is a Russian freestyle wrestler who competes at 65 kilograms. [1] Shakhiev is the 2021 World Champion and European Champion, as well as a two-time Russian National medalist and a Cadet World Champion. [2]
Shakiev, of Chechen descent, [3] [4] started wrestling at the age of eight, and went on to become the 2016 Cadet World Champion at 46 kilograms. [5] After competing at some international tournaments in Russia and Armenia, he broke into the senior level scene in 2020, claiming a bronze medal from the 2020 Russian National Championships, [6] and followed the roll by claiming a silver medal in 2021, only losing to reigning World Champion from Dagestan Gadzhimurad Rashidov in the finals. [7] After his performance at the 2021 Russian Nationals, Sakhiev claimed the 2021 European Continental Championship in April. [2]
As a replacement for returning World Champion Gadzhimurad Rashidov, Sakhiev travelled to Norway in order to compete at the 2021 World Championships from 3 to 4 October. [8] An underdog to win the championship, he battled on his way to the finale, notably defeating former Junior and University World Champion Selahattin Kılıçsallayan and '19 U23 Asian champion Tömör-Ochiryn Tulga to advance to the next date. [9] Sakhiev dominated over Amir Mohammad Yazdani to claim the crown and become the 2021 World Champion on 4 October. [10]
In 2022, he won the silver medal in his event at the Yasar Dogu Tournament held in Istanbul, Turkey. [11]
